Rosamund Pike is opening up about a deeply personal and terrifying experience from nearly two decades ago — one that still resonates with her today.
In a candid interview with Magic Radio, the Gone Girl star revealed that she was mugged and punched in the face during a phone robbery in London back in 2006. What started as a normal phone call with her mother quickly turned into a nightmare.
“I was on the phone to my mother… and I was mugged,” Pike said. “The phone was snatched. All she heard was me scream and a thud — and then the line went dead.”

Her mother, on the other end of the phone, experienced her own trauma. “She endured 15 minutes of hell,” Pike said, before she was able to call her back after the mugging incident.
This resurfaced story arrives at a time when London authorities are reporting a 151% rise in mobile phone thefts, with similar attacks becoming disturbingly common.
